Genel Energy Announces New Non-Exec Director

Genel Energy, the London listed E&P company and largest independent oil producer in the Kurdistan Region of Iraq, announced on Friday that it has appointed Chakib Sbiti as an independent non-executive director with immediate effect. Iranian Carmaker to Build Factory in Iraq

Iranian carmaker Saipa is to build a car assembly plant in Iraq. The factory will have capacity to output as many as 120,000 cars per year if operated around the clock. Etihad Commences Flights Between Abu Dhabi and Basra

Etihad Airways, the national airline of the United Arab Emirates, this week launched its inaugural flight from Abu Dhabi to Basra in southern Iraq. Exxon Dropped from 4th Energy Round; Full List Published

Exxon Mobil is conspicuously absent from the finalized list of 47 pre-qualified bidders for the Iraq's fourth round of energy exploration rights. The Petroleum Contracts and Licensing Directorate (PCLD) at the Ministry of Oil has confirmed that the auction will take place as scheduled on May 30-31. Iraq Seeks Refinery Investors

Iraq's Deputy Oil Minister, Ahmed al-Shamma, said the country wants to gradually privatise its oil refineries and to attract investment in new plants. Swedish Transport Academy Inaugurated in Erbil

The Swedish Transport Academy, officially inaugurated this week in Erbil, will help Iraq’s unemployed and young people acquire the new industrial skills critical for the reconstruction and recovery of the country`s economy. Iraq Allocates $85m to Boost Public Companies

The Iraqi government has allocated 100bn IQD ($85m) from the 2012 budget to kick start loss-making state-owned companies and make them profitable, according to AKnews. Iraq Still Hopes to Award Joint Nassiriya Oilfield, Refinery Deal

Iraq's deputy oil minister, Ahmed al-Shamma, said that Iraq still hopes to award a contract for the development of the 4.4 billion barrel Nassiriya oil field and the construction of a dedicated 300,000 bpd export refinery as one package. Women's Ministry Grants Bank Loans Worth 10m Dinars

AKnews reports that the Iraqi Ministry for Women's Affairs has granted about 10m dinars' worth of bank loans for women. Ministry spokesman Mohammed Hamza said the loans are part of the project submitted by the Ministry of Labour and Social Affairs for women who are unemployed and registered with the ministry.
